Slow Love: Crafting Bold Visual Stories with a Modern Vintage Sans Serif

When you’re building a brand, every detail communicates something. The imagery, the color palette, and most critically, the typography. You’re likely searching for a typeface that doesn’t just sit there looking pretty, but one that actively works to build recognition and trust. Enter Slow Love, a sophisticated sans serif font designed for creators who value impact without sacrificing elegance. It’s not just another geometric typeface; it is a design asset that bridges the gap between contemporary minimalism and a warm, vintage soul.

I’ve worked with hundreds of typefaces over the years, and the ones that stick around in my toolkit are the ones that offer versatility without losing their distinct voice. Slow Love manages to feel sturdy and bold—perfect for headlines—while retaining a clean, modern look that keeps it from feeling dated. If you are working on logo design, packaging, or editorial layouts, understanding how to wield this font can significantly elevate your output.

The Anatomy of "Modern Vintage"

Typography often feels like a binary choice: either you go full retro, or you stick to stark modernism. Slow Love rejects that binary. Its visual personality is best described as "modern vintage." It features the heavy weight and solid construction of a mid-century advertising typeface, but it cleans up those lines with the precision of contemporary geometric design. This creates a vibe that is chic, stylish, and undeniably professional.

What makes it stand out in a crowded market of premium fonts? It’s the details. The font includes geometric alternates and ligatures, allowing you to customize the flow of your text. For example, if you are designing a logotype for a streetwear label, you can swap standard letters for geometric alternates to create a more abstract, cutting-edge look. Conversely, for a high-end beauty brand, the ligatures can connect letters to add a touch of fluidity and sophistication. It’s a heavy-hitter in terms of visual weight, making it ideal for contexts where you need to grab attention immediately—think posters, magazine covers, and hero sections on a website.

Influencing Perception and Readability

Choosing a typeface is a psychological decision as much as an aesthetic one. The fonts you use shape how your audience perceives your brand before they even read a word of your copy. Slow Love communicates stability, creativity, and a forward-thinking mindset. It avoids the coldness that some minimal sans serifs suffer from, thanks to its subtle rounded edges and vintage undertones.

However, as with any heavyweight display font, readability requires strategy. You wouldn’t want to set a 10-page report in Slow Love at 12pt; that would be visually exhausting. Instead, treat it as a display font. It shines at larger sizes—think headlines, sub-headers, and call-to-action buttons. When used correctly, it creates a rhythm in your design. The boldness of the headers gives the reader a break, allowing the lighter body text to do the heavy lifting of conveying information. This balance is crucial for maintaining audience engagement, especially in digital environments where eye strain is a real concern.

Integrating Slow Love into Your Workflow

So, you’re convinced this might be the right fit. How do you actually go about implementing it? First, look at the font pairing. Because Slow Love is so bold and geometric, it pairs best with something softer or more traditional. Try combining it with a light-weight serif font for a high-contrast editorial look, or a simple handwritten script for a personal, artisanal touch. Avoid pairing it with other heavy sans serifs, or the design will feel cluttered and aggressive.

Next, check the licensing. If you are a small business owner or entrepreneur, ensure you have the correct commercial license. Most premium font foundries offer different tiers—desktop licenses for print, webfont licenses for your site, and app licenses if you’re developing software. Respecting these licenses isn’t just legal; it supports the designers who create these tools.

Finally, test it in context. Don’t just look at the specimen sheet. Mock up your actual logo. Place it on your actual website header. See how the letters interact with your specific brand colors. Slow Love is versatile, but like any design asset, it needs to be tested in the wild to ensure it aligns with your specific vision. When it clicks, though, you’ll know. It transforms a standard layout into something that feels curated, intentional, and undeniably stylish.
